What is Mylar Speaker Technology?

Mylar speakers utilize polyethylene terephthalate (PET) film as the diaphragm material, offering superior acoustic properties compared to conventional speaker materials. The unique molecular structure of Mylar provides exceptional stiffness-to-weight ratio, enabling precise high-frequency reproduction with minimal distortion. These characteristics make Mylar particularly valuable in applications where sound clarity and durability are paramount, including premium headphones, automotive audio systems, and professional studio monitors.

The material's inherent moisture resistance and thermal stability further enhance its appeal across diverse operating environments, from humid climates to temperature-fluctuating automotive interiors. Unlike traditional paper or polypropylene cones, Mylar diaphragms maintain their acoustic properties over extended periods, reducing performance degradation.

2. Automotive Audio Revolution

Modern vehicles are transforming into acoustic environments rivaling home theaters, with 60% of new car buyers prioritizing premium audio systems. The shift toward electric vehicles (EVs) has further amplified this trend - without engine noise, cabin acoustics become more critical. Automotive OEMs are adopting Mylar speakers for their:

  • Exceptional off-axis response for balanced sound throughout the cabin
  • Resistance to temperature fluctuations in vehicle environments
  • Lightweight properties that reduce overall vehicle weight

Leading luxury automakers now incorporate Mylar speakers in their 3D surround sound systems, with adoption rates growing at 18% annually.

Market Challenges

While the outlook remains positive, the industry faces several hurdles:

  • Cost competition: Alternative materials like polypropylene cost 25-40% less, making them preferred for budget segments

  • Supply chain constraints: Recent petrochemical market volatility has caused raw material price fluctuations up to 30%

  • Technical limitations: Mylar requires complementary components for full-range sound reproduction, increasing system complexity
